I've now realised in the Design table for the widget you can make pivot tables show up to 200 rows on the same page, so helpful but anything above that will go onto another page again.
I've tried setting pivot table pages to include 200 rows, but when I go to download the pdf, I can only extend this widget to the bottom of its one page in edit mode; I can't make the pdf add additional pages to show all rows. I get 39 rows max in the download. Were you able to get more rows to show up in the pdf? Thanks!
I've gotten 58 rows to show. I think that it might have to do with how many rows you are showing in the box for the widget on the screen display of the dashboard. If the box only shows 39 rows then even if you have set that the height is 200 rows you will only see the 39 rows in the pivot table in the .PDF that results.
